Output 61c888c5d3e363b19fb529d4c41fbc4c57053237da7b11a5eff8ee3543e68117:0

value
23178115013
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bf663b2a08823b4b2ea1097e7cd96544e336e40 OP_EQUALVERIFY OP_CHECKSIG
address
1Dm466yzQdsqBy3dr5gNLg82VhFMhEdd7D
transaction
61c888c5d3e363b19fb529d4c41fbc4c57053237da7b11a5eff8ee3543e68117
spent
true